Parental Involvement and Academic Achievement of Secondary School Students

Author(s) Mr. Upendra Padhan
Country India
Abstract The present study research aims to explore the parental involvement and academic achievement of secondary school student. The objectives of the study were to investigate the parental involvement and academic achievement of secondary school student, to study the parental involvement of in the education of secondary schools student, to study the relationship between the parental involvement and academic achievement of secondary school students, to study the impact of parental involvement on academic achievement of secondary school students. In order to accomplish the objectives of present study descriptive survey, cum causal comparative cum correlation methods was used. To accomplish the objectives .the research was conducted in Kalahandi district in Karlamunda block secondary school student. A total number of sample 100 students of 9th and 10th class of secondary school students were taken as respondents.10 school was selected through simple random sampling, which includes 10 students from each school. In the present study survey questionnaire was used as a tools for data collection .in order to collect of data from the sample group parental involvement rating scale (PIRS) developed by C. Naseema & Abdul Gafoor in (2001). This scale includes three items. The scale of validity is 0.72 and reliability is 0.61.
